Reservations are recommended via Recreation.gov, and camping fees apply. Amenities include flush toilets, drinking water, fire rings/grills, and picnic tables. The campground offers a peaceful, lakeside setting with forested surroundings, perfect for fishing, boating, and wildlife viewing. Nearby attractions include Hugo Lake State Park trails and the Endangered Ark Foundation elephant sanctuary. The best time to visit is spring through fall for mild weather and full facility availability. Dispersed camping is not permitted within the park.
